Microstructure of flow-driven suspension of hardspheres in cylindrical confinement: a dynamical density functional theory and Monte Carlo study

We have studied the microstructure of a flow-driven hardsphere suspension inside a cylinder using dynamical density functional theory and Monte Carlo simulations.
